CARNAL FORGE: New Lineup Revealed
07 Feb 2008
Swedish thrashers CARNAL FORGE have confirmed that they have parted ways with Jari Kuusisto (rhythm guitar) and Jens C. Mortensen (vocals). "We are sorry not to have the guys on board anymore, and we wish them all the best for the future," the group writes in a statement. "We want to thank them for all their work and efforts in the band and all the crazy times we've shared through the years... Cheers!!!"
The band continues: "The good news is that we have found two new members to replace Jari and Jens: Dino Medanhodzic (SOULBREACH) on lead guitar and Peter Tuthill (ex-CONSTRUCDEAD, and also in GODSIC) on vocals.

JANI LANE BACK WITH WARRANT?
31 Jan 2008
Evidently Jani Lane has returned to the WARRANT fold, given that his photo is now included with the rest of the band members' pictures, at guitarist Erik Turner's MySpace page. Meanwhile, rumors have been circulating that a Jani Lane fronted Warrant will perform at the second annual Rocklahoma festival, to be held in Pryor, Oklahoma July 11th -13th. MOONSPELL: New Album Title Revealed
14 Jan 2008
Portuguese metallers MOONSPELL entered Antfarm studios in Denmark earlier this month with producer Tue Madsen (THE HAUNTED, DARK TRANQUILLITY, HALFORD) to begin recording the follow-up to 2006's "Memorial" for a tentative late spring/early summer release via SPV.
Commented vocalist Fernando Ribeiro: "'Night Eternal' will be the title of the new MOONSPELL album. The recording sessions will take place between the 7th and the 31st of January 2008 in Denmark's finest metal studio, Antfarm.
